
O que há de novo: App Builder com ações de dados condicionais, Grid Master-Detail e muito mais
A atualização de junho do App Builder apresenta uma nova onda de recursos de produtividade projetados para acelerar o desenvolvimento de aplicativos e simplificar as interações do usuário. De ações de dados condicionais à localização em espanhol e muito mais - explore tudo isso agora.
Nosso lançamento App Builder em junho apresenta uma nova onda de recursos de produtividade projetados para acelerar o desenvolvimento de aplicativos e simplificar as interações do usuário. Tendo App Builder com as Ações de Dados Condicionais, agora você pode criar uma lógica mais inteligente em seus fluxos de trabalho com base no sucesso ou falha das chamadas de API, sem necessidade de código. O novo modelo de detalhes mestre de grade permite enriquecer visualmente os dados da linha com exibições expansíveis e sensíveis ao contexto. E para equipes globais, estamos introduzindo a localização em espanhol em toda a plataforma. Combinado com o novo recurso de roteamento no nível filho, aprimoramentos de tempo de design e variantes de interface do usuário expandidas, como botões de ícone contornados e contidos, esta versão coloca mais poder de design e controle lógico ao seu alcance.

Antes de mergulhar nessas novas funcionalidades, se esta é a primeira vez que você aprende sobre App Builder, deixe-me compartilhar rapidamente por que você deve considerá-lo uma ferramenta fundamental no processo de desenvolvimento de aplicativos para sua organização:
- Um construtor de aplicativos visuais – a plataforma unificada para executivos de nível C, arquitetos corporativos, líderes de equipe de desenvolvimento, designers, desenvolvedores e partes interessadas.
- Ferramenta de arrastar e soltar WYSIWYG baseada em nuvem que ajuda as empresas a projetar e criar aplicativos de negócios completos 80% mais rápido do que nunca.
- Uma ferramenta low-code gera código pronto para produção para Angular, React, Web Components e Blazor e converte Figma designs em código.
O que há de novo nesta versão App Builder?
Aprimore sua grade com modelos mestre-detalhe
Os modelos de detalhes mestres em App Builder trazem interatividade poderosa para suas grades de dados. Ao habilitar linhas expansíveis, você pode permitir que os usuários revelem mais detalhes vinculados a cada registro, como pedidos recentes de um cliente, desempenho de um funcionário ou histórico de viagens de um veículo, diretamente na grade.
Com o suporte intuitivo de tempo de design do App Builder, você pode arrastar e soltar componentes como cartões ou blocos de texto na área de detalhes expandida e vinculá-los ao contexto de dados da linha atual. É uma maneira rápida e flexível de criar interfaces de usuário informativas que vão além das tabelas planas.
Para usá-lo, basta ativar a opção Grid-details no painel Propriedades, adicionar seus componentes e vinculá-los aos dados da linha.
Vejamos a demonstração a seguir.

A demonstração acima mostra um layout Master-Detail em ação, aplicado em um aplicativo de CRM. Ele demonstra como a seleção de um cliente revela seus pedidos associados e, além disso, como cada pedido carrega dinamicamente seus detalhes de pedidos relacionados.
Nesta configuração:
- A visualização principal exibe uma lista de clientes e, ao selecionar um cliente, você pode ver seus pedidos.
- Uma grade secundária de detalhes do pedido foi adicionada, que está vinculada ao contexto de linha do pedido selecionado.
- Essa associação orientada por contexto garante que, quando um usuário selecionar um pedido específico, a Grade de Detalhes do Pedido seja atualizada para mostrar apenas as informações relevantes.
Isso demonstra a facilidade com que você pode criar uma experiência de detalhamento usando a associação de dados contextual, permitindo que os usuários explorem relacionamentos de dados hierárquicos sem fiação manual ou código extra.
Visualize tudo ao vivo e exporte seu aplicativo com o código gerado. Lembre-se de que associações avançadas específicas, como fontes de dados parametrizadas por linha ou componentes de sobreposição, como caixas de diálogo, não têm suporte atualmente na geração de código. Dê uma olhada no tópico de ajuda completo aqui.
Fluxos de trabalho mais inteligentes: App Builder com ações de dados condicionais
Com esta versão, App Builder apresenta as Ações de Dados Condicionais, uma maneira poderosa de controlar o comportamento do aplicativo com base no resultado de uma solicitação de dados. Agora você pode definir ações de acompanhamento que são acionadas somente se a ação inicial for bem-sucedida ou falhar. Por exemplo, mostre um banner de sucesso após um envio de formulário bem-sucedido ou solicite uma mensagem de erro se ele falhar.

Esse recurso mantém as coisas limpas e focadas: as condições estão atualmente limitadas apenas a ações de dados e suportam uma avaliação simples de aprovação/reprovação sem a necessidade de verificar códigos HTTP específicos. Você também pode usar variáveis dentro de condições e se beneficiar de menus suspensos contextuais que ajudam a esclarecer se você está fazendo referência a uma entrada, a um resultado ou a uma variável definida pelo usuário. É um passo fundamental em direção a uma lógica de aplicativo mais inteligente e responsiva, sem necessidade de codificação.
A demonstração abaixo mostra a saída de Ações Condicionais em ação em um aplicativo HR Dashboard. Ele demonstra como você pode aprimorar o fluxo do seu aplicativo manipulando dinamicamente o processo de adição de um novo funcionário e oferecendo navegação contextual com base no resultado.
Aqui está o que acontece:
- Quando uma nova linha é adicionada à Grade de Funcionários, uma Ação Condicional dispara uma solicitação PUT para o back-end.
- Se a solicitação for bem-sucedida, duas coisas acontecerão:
- Uma variável é definida para armazenar o objeto de funcionário recém-criado.
- Uma notificação de barra de lanches é exibida, confirmando o sucesso e oferecendo um botão de navegação para uma visualização detalhada do formulário pré-preenchida com os dados do novo funcionário.
- Se a solicitação falhar, uma janela de diálogo será exibida para notificar o usuário sobre o problema.
- Após editar o funcionário na Visualização do Formulário e enviar atualizações, uma segunda lanchonete aparece, guiando o usuário para a Visualização da Equipe, onde ele pode ver a lista completa de funcionários, agora incluindo o recém-adicionado ou atualizado.
Esse fluxo ilustra como as Ações Condicionais podem orquestrar uma experiência do usuário (UX) perfeita e em várias etapas, desde a criação de dados até a fácil navegação no aplicativo, sem exigir uma única linha de código.

Hola! App Builder agora suporta espanhol
App Builder agora oferece localização em espanhol, tornando mais fácil para os usuários que falam espanhol navegar na superfície de design, caixa de ferramentas, painéis de propriedades e muito mais. Esta atualização garante uma experiência mais acessível e inclusiva, adaptando automaticamente a interface com base nas configurações ou preferências de idioma do seu navegador.
Introdução ao roteamento no nível filho com parâmetros de caminho e consulta
Temos o prazer de anunciar um grande aprimoramento no roteamento no App Builder— suporte total para roteamento no nível filho com parâmetros de caminho e consulta. Esse recurso apresenta a capacidade de configurar contêineres de exibições aninhados (saídas de roteador) dentro da hierarquia de aplicativos, permitindo que os desenvolvedores projetem estruturas de navegação de vários níveis sem esforço. Esteja você criando uma experiência de detalhes mestre (por exemplo) Customers → Orders → OrderDetails
ou uma interface do usuário profundamente aninhada, App Builder agora oferece suporte a hierarquias de roteamento de até cinco níveis de profundidade, completas com aprimoramentos de interface do usuário para os Seletores de Navegação e Destino para uma configuração mais intuitiva.
Parâmetros de consulta, lógica de navegação e comportamento de tempo de execução
Além dos parâmetros de caminho, App Builder agora inclui suporte robusto a parâmetros de consulta para todas as plataformas, incluindo estratégias para lidar com vários parâmetros com o mesmo nome. A lógica de geração de código foi atualizada para refletir o uso correto do parâmetro de consulta e se integra perfeitamente às ações de roteamento. Além disso, o comportamento de navegação foi aprimorado: navegar até a raiz (/
) agora detalha automaticamente a rota válida mais profunda, parando apenas quando um parâmetro necessário é indefinido. Esse comportamento de roteamento inteligente aprimora a experiência de visualização do aplicativo e define a base para a criação de fluxos de navegação complexos e controlados por dados com confiança.
Novas variantes de botão de ícone: contido e delineado
App Builder agora oferece suporte às variantes Contido e Contornado para o componente Botão de ícone, alinhando-o com as opções disponíveis em nossos sistemas de design e kits de interface do usuário Figma. Esses novos estilos oferecem maior flexibilidade para combinar com o tom visual do seu aplicativo, quer você esteja buscando uma aparência ousada e preenchida ou um contorno minimalista. A atualização fornece suporte total em toda a plataforma, incluindo configuração de tempo de design na interface do usuário do App Builder, geração de código precisa com definições de componentes atualizadas e importação contínua de Figma para manter um fluxo consistente de design para código.
Conclusão
O lançamento de maio reflete nosso compromisso contínuo em fornecer experiências de aplicativos escaláveis e modernas em App Builder. Esteja você projetando grades de dados complexas, aplicando regras de validação robustas ou simplificando fluxos de trabalho de DevOps, esta atualização oferece as ferramentas para avançar mais rapidamente e criar melhor.
Experimente os novos recursos hoje mesmo no appbuilder.dev
App Builder é um divisor de águas no processo de desenvolvimento de aplicativos. Com seu construtor visual baseado em nuvem, recursos de baixo código e novos recursos, é uma ferramenta obrigatória para qualquer organização. Experimente hoje! Se precisar de mais detalhes, recomendamos que você confira nosso:
Para experimentar tudo nas últimas atualizações do App Builder, visite o portal do cliente e obtenha a versão mais recente. Como de costume, estamos sempre ansiosos para receber seus comentários e ouvir o que você deseja adicionar ou recomendar. Então, por favor, envie-me um e-mail para zkolev@appbuilder.dev e deixe-me saber como podemos ajudá-lo a continuar agregando valor aos seus clientes com a Infragistics.
